This group is for people who wish to walk between 5 and 7 miles over varied terrain, on a regular basis. Group membership is limited to 20 members. Being a collaborative, it is hoped that each member will lead or be back marker for a walk at least once per year, and also help and assist less confident map readers to reconnoitre walks to lead. There will be a break of about 15mins at some point in the walk, for water and possibly sustenance (often called a banana break). Walkers should be fit enough to cover 7 miles with the break, within 3hrs. The groups walks will generally be within a 16 mile radius of Worcester city centre.

Walks will generally start from a Pub. This being so, walkers are encouraged to car share to minimise the spaces taken on the pub car park and to maintain a greener footprint. Walkers using Pub car parks are expected to at least have a drink in the pub afterwards or join, what is hoped will be the majority, for a light lunch and a wind down chat after the walk. Good relationships with Publicans are best maintained when we don't take up spaces which paying customers could use. Some locations will no longer accept walking groups as this courtesy has not been observed.

When we start from somewhere other than a pub car park, it is anticipated that, after the walk, we will adjourn to a nearby hostelry, to wind down.

Health and safety stuff
From a health and safety perspective, each walker is responsible for their own well being and, that of the person directly in front of them, getting a message to the walk leader or back marker should anything untoward happen. Also when walkers are spread out, each walker is required to ensure that the walker behind them does not miss a turning.

Walkers should ensure they wear clothing suitable for the conditions. Sometimes it will be muddy (See Picture in the slide show above). It will rain, it can be cold or windy. Layers, sun hats, Boots, Gaiters, Poles (Two or non is advisably safer than one). When using poles ensure they are carried and used with due diligence, We don't want claims for lost eyes or stabbed knee caps.

Where possible, walk leaders will advise on anticipated conditions. Walks may be cancelled in severe conditions. It is intended to set up a WhatsApp group for rapid communication. Also, notification will be as laid out in the following link.

U3a walking groups also organise a collective annual walking holiday, which is open to members of any walking group, and is on a full board basis in one of the hotels operated by HF Holidays. Each day there is a selection of walks organised by group members providing a choice of terrain and distance.

The UK walking holiday in September 2026 is in the Peak District. (28th September - 2nd October 2026) The HF Hotel is "The Peveril of the Peak" in Dovedale - a beautiful aspect and only 2 hours drive from Worcester.
